
Two Uncommon Ways to Pray
From The Disciple-Making Parent AudioBlog by Chap Bettis
May 27, 2026 · 5 min
About this episode
This episode discusses two uncommon ways for parents to pray for their children.
Are you praying for your children? I hope you are. This episode gives you two other ways you may not have thought about. To read the original post, visit https://www.theapollosproject.com/two-uncommon-ways-a-parent-can-pray/
